Italy vs United Kingdom: tax rates compared

Between the two, Italy's income tax rate (47.2%) tops United Kingdom's (45%) by 2.2pp. The 200-country average is 28%: both sit above it.

six shared taxes, side by side
Tax IT GBDifference
Income Tax47.2%45%IT +2.2 pp
Corporate Tax27.8%25%IT +2.8 pp
VAT22%20%IT +2 pp
Capital Gains Tax26%24%IT +2 pp
Crypto Tax33%24%IT +9 pplargest gap
Wealth Tax0%0%match
